Hello, Dear GRASS Users. I am working with GRASS 7.0.4 (Win10-64bit) and got a problem with saved workspaces (*.gxw files). After saving a GRASS session as a workspace and re-opening the respective *.gxw file, the saved layers appear but it is not possible to edit them. The layers can not be marked or clicked. New layers (vector or raster layer) added to the same workspace are also not editable. However, creating a new GRASS session with the same layers works fine.
